stiff

12 senses · Free VividLex dictionary · Thesaurus

  1. 1. superl. Not easily bent; not flexible or pliant; not limber or flaccid; rigid; firm; as, stiff wood, paper, joints. Source: opted
  2. 2. superl. Not liquid or fluid; thick and tenacious; inspissated; neither soft nor hard; as, the paste is stiff. Source: opted
  3. 3. superl. Firm; strong; violent; difficult to oppose; as, a stiff gale or breeze. Source: opted
  4. 4. superl. Not easily subdued; unyielding; stubborn; obstinate; pertinacious; as, a stiff adversary. Source: opted
  5. 5. superl. Not natural and easy; formal; constrained; affected; starched; as, stiff behavior; a stiff style. Source: opted
  6. 6. superl. Harsh; disagreeable; severe; hard to bear. Source: opted
  7. 7. superl. Bearing a press of canvas without careening much; as, a stiff vessel; -- opposed to crank. Source: opted
  8. 8. superl. Very large, strong, or costly; powerful; as, a stiff charge; a stiff price. Source: opted
  9. 9. adj. not moving or operating freely Source: wordnet
  10. 10. adj. strong, vigorous Source: wordnet
  11. 11. adj. rigidly formal Source: wordnet
  12. 12. adj. having a strong physiological or chemical effect Source: wordnet
